Set Your Air Conditioner Between 23 to 26 Degrees

Optimal Temperature Settings: Setting your air conditioner between 23-26°C reduces energy usage and costs, while optimising efficiency and maintaining comfort for effective indoor climate control.
Energy Efficiency: Operating your air conditioner between 23 to 26 degrees Celsius reduces the load on the unit, enhancing its efficiency and extending its lifespan, thereby saving energy and maintenance costs.
Programmable Thermostats: Consider using programmable thermostats to adjust temperatures based on occupancy patterns and time of day. This allows you to avoid cooling empty rooms and reduces overall energy usage.
Night-time Adjustments: Lowering the temperature slightly at night enhances sleep comfort without significantly increasing energy costs, offering a balance between restful sleep and energy efficiency during summer.

Let the Cooler Air In

Natural Ventilation and Cross Ventilation: Use cooler morning and evening temperatures by turning off your air conditioner and opening windows and doors. This promotes natural airflow, cooling your home. Opening windows on opposite sides facilitates cross-ventilation, creating a breeze and reducing reliance on mechanical systems.
Window Coverings and Night Purge: Use window coverings like blinds or curtains to block direct sunlight during the hottest parts of the day, preventing heat gain and keeping indoor temperatures lower. At night, expel daytime heat with cooler air, refreshing your home and lowering energy consumption.

Seal and Insulate Your Home

Energy Efficiency Improvements:

Seal air leaks around windows, doors, and ducts to maintain a steady indoor temperature, minimising the workload on your cooling system and cutting energy consumption. Additionally, invest in adequate insulation for your attic, walls, and floors to enhance thermal efficiency and reduce heat transfer throughout your home.

Enhancing Home Efficiency:

Install weather-stripping around doors and windows to further decrease air leakage, ensuring your home retains its temperature more effectively. Consider conducting a home energy audit to pinpoint areas for improvement. This audit helps prioritise cost-effective upgrades that maximise energy savings and enhance overall energy efficiency.

Practice Smart Cooling Habits

1. Use Fans

Use ceiling or portable fans to boost airflow, creating a cooling effect that lets you raise the thermostat comfortably.

2. Block Sunlight

During the day, close blinds, shades, or curtains to block sunlight and reduce solar heat gain in south- and west-facing windows.

3. Minimise Heat-Generating Activities

Avoid cooking on stovetops or using large appliances during the hottest parts of the day to prevent overtaxing your air conditioner.

4. Dress Appropriately

Wear light, breathable clothing and use lighter bedding to stay comfortable without lowering the thermostat.

Optimise Your HVAC System

Regular Maintenance: Regularly schedule HVAC system maintenance to uphold optimal performance and energy efficiency, ensuring effective operation and prolonged lifespan of heating and cooling systems.
Clean or Replace Filters: Clean or replace air filters as recommended to improve airflow and reduce strain on your HVAC equipment, leading to lower energy consumption and an extended lifespan.
Smart Thermostats: Consider upgrading to a programmable or smart thermostat to automate temperature adjustments and maximise energy savings based on your schedule and preferences.
Ductwork Inspection: Regularly inspect and clean ductwork to maintain efficient airflow, preventing energy loss and ensuring optimal performance of your HVAC system.

Unplug Electronics and Appliances When Not in Use

Reduce Standby Power Consumption: Unplug electronics and appliances when idle or use smart power strips to disconnect multiple devices simultaneously, reducing standby power consumption and conserving energy effectively.
Turn Off Non-Essential Appliances: Turn off lights, computers, televisions, and other non-essential appliances when leaving a room or going to bed to avoid unnecessary energy waste.
Energy-Efficient Lighting: Swap incandescent bulbs with energy-efficient LED or CFL bulbs to decrease energy usage and heat emission, enhancing both environmental sustainability and indoor comfort levels.
Charge Wisely: Charge devices during daylight hours to utilise abundant solar energy, and disconnect them upon reaching full charge to avoid overcharging and optimise energy usage efficiency.

Harness Natural Light and Ventilation

Enhancing Natural Light and Ventilation:

Optimise natural daylighting and ventilation by strategically arranging furniture and decor to maximise light exposure while minimising solar heat and glare. Install energy-efficient windows, skylights, or light tubes to enhance natural light penetration, improving indoor comfort and ambiance.

Improving Ventilation and Cooling:

Implement passive ventilation strategies like ventilated roof spaces and open-plan designs to enhance air circulation and cooling efficiency. Additionally, plant shade trees and use awnings or external shading devices to reduce direct sunlight entering your home, further enhancing indoor comfort and energy efficiency.
